How do digital and print cover designs differ in adult magazine publishing?

In adult magazine publishing, digital and print cover designs showcase unique characteristics.

Digital Covers:

  • Focus on dynamic visuals and interactive elements.
  • Capture attention online with flexible design elements.

Print Covers:

  • Rely on tactile sensations and high-quality imagery.
  • Use physical attributes like embossing or foil stamping for a luxurious feel.

Both formats play a vital role in engaging audiences.
